Video thumbnail for Top 10 Romantic Hill Stations in India

Top 10 Romantic Hill Stations in India

Apr 8, 2023

travelikan.com

Confused about where to go for your honeymoon. Here are the Top 10 Romantic Hill Stations in India for honeymoon.
#Travel & Transportation #Tourist Destinations